Sat 694250198545409

decimal
138850.198545409
degree
0°138850′1762″198545409‴
percentile
33.0595333004326%
name
ixwptktubcq
cycle
0
epoch
0
period
68
block
138850
offset
198545409
timestamp
rarity
common